Transaction 70e13b504d68e1d021db05f8253ffe38098c5a5de41e10c8fe0aaa1aabeddf17

1 Input
1 Outputs
  • 70e13b504d68e1d021db05f8253ffe38098c5a5de41e10c8fe0aaa1aabeddf17:0
  • value  799496863
    address  32ppLK9SwCztQiuMhHKZ4VfRcMz5pg19RD